CHESTERTOWN, Md. – The Washington College men's swim team won its home opener by taking the best time in all 11 events on Saturday afternoon in a 149-45 win over visiting McDaniel at the Casey Swim Center in Centennial Conference men's swimming action.

Shoremen Highlights
-
James Hackett captured two events on the afternoon as he won the 100-yard freestyle (49.92) and the 200 freestyle (1:49.70).
-
Nathan Rawa won a pair of events for the Shoremen as he took top spot in the 50 freestyle (21.68) and the 100 butterfly (51.60).
-
William Schmidt notched two victories in the 200 individual medley (2:04.52) and 500 freestyle (5:14.49).
- Winning one event each were
Joey Bond in the 100 breaststroke (1:03.72),
Niles Commodore in the 100 backstroke (57.27) and
Connor Kravitz-Yoffee in the 1000 freestyle (10:42.26).
- The 200 medley relay team of
Gabe Summa,
Brody Salpeter,
Tyler Wright and Commodore secured first place with a time of 1:42.19 and the 200 freestyle relay squad of Commodore, Hackett,
Mike Lee and Rawa took top time in 1:27.98.
Notes
- The Shoremen are now 2-2 overall and 2-2 in the Centennial and the Green Terror fall to 0-3 and 0-3 respectively.
